Output 34ebd879059c3ccf303b4b92bb9dd94cf939d7b74ca6a59d7bb6083af1b5921e:0

value
12682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ea9ab42fd61c486fdc61b6c12477156b4d88670d OP_EQUAL
address
3P5VNSj4f9EKEFfQknz9EQuJp8LgZQgXeD
transaction
34ebd879059c3ccf303b4b92bb9dd94cf939d7b74ca6a59d7bb6083af1b5921e
spent
true